    Hardcover. Condition: new. Hardcover. Secrecy and the act of concealing and revealing knowledge effectually segregate the initiated and the uninitiated. The act of sharing or hiding knowledge plays a central role in all human relations private or public, political or religious. This volume explores the concept of secrecy and its implications in Antiquity, Late Antiquity and the Renaissance in eleven cross-disciplinary contributions using both textual and archaeological sources. By exploring the revealing and concealing of knowledge across different social contexts, time frames and geographical locations, the book provides insight into the concept of secrecy and its potential for illuminating the agendas behind identity constructions, political propaganda, literary works, religous practices and shared history. Concealing and revealing knowledge has shaped social, political and religious spheres across Antiquity, Late Antiquity and the Renaissance. Eleven interdisciplinary contributions analyze texts and artifacts to expose how secrecy molded identities, propaganda, literature and rituals through diverse cultural lenses.     Buch. Condition: Neu. Neuware -Style can be considered as the way or technique in which an author communicates a message. Style concerns the way a text presents itself, or the form and shape of a text as different from its content, even though style also, in various ways, is inseparable from content. The style of a text concerns the way a text presents itself through sounds, visual impression, words, sentences, figures, and content, thereby creating a unique voice, tone, feeling, and atmosphere of the text. Style could also be considered as the how of a text as different from its what. 'What' concerns the content of a text; 'how' concerns the style, way, or technique in which the text presents itself. If an author chooses to delete all elements of style in order that the text has no style, it nonetheless is a stylistic choice which effects the meaning of the text. Even a shopping list exhibits a certain style, though it may try to reduce all stylistic choices in favour of a focus on content. Style cannot be annulled or cancelled, but some texts are more prone to stylistic analyses than others. In this volume, the contributors theorise five distinct levels of style, and analyse style in New Testament texts and contemporary Greek and Latin literature. 355 pp. Englisch.
